Square Enix is now taking pitches from developers via its Collective service for ideas that utilise its classic properties Gex, Fear Effect and Anachronox.
“It’s been almost a year since we fully launched Collective, and one of the headline announcements back then was the prospect of allowing developers to create games based in some of the old Eidos IPs. But it wasn’t something I wanted to open up right away, in case it overshadowed the original games that developers submitted to the platform,” explained Square Enix.
“Well, now the platform is established and we’ve more experience in supporting projects (both in Feedback and through crowdfunding) so it feels like the right time to live up to that early promise – which means that from now on, we’re going to allow developers to pitch game ideas based on the following IPs:”
- Gex
- Fear Effect
- Anachronox
If your idea is chosen then there’s a few business terms you’ll need to be aware of.
“On the business side, we’ll still take 5% of net crowdfunds raised (assuming the initial target is reached); and we will also distribute the game when it’s done – for that we take the standard distribution fee of 10% net sales revenue, but we’ll also charge a 10% license fee for the use of the IP,” Square continues. “And, obviously, we’ll have more involvement in the direction of development – because let’s face it, we want to make sure the game that’s released is the game that’s promised.
“Still, that means the developer will keep 80% of the net revenue from sales of the game – and who knows, maybe we’ll be interested in licensing a sequel as well? It’s a pretty good deal.”
Square Enix says it may open up more IPs in the future.
